22 Yuji Nakazawa

Position: Defender
Born: 25.02.78
Club: Yokohama F. Marinos

Centre-back Yuji Nakazawa formed a formidable defensive partnership with Tsuneyasu Miyamoto during the qualification campaign and providing he stays fit, he will almost certainly be in Zico's starting XI in Germany.

The 28-year-old was named J-League Player of the Year two years ago and is highly respected in Asia.

He did not feature at last summer's Confederations Cup due to the recurrence of an arthritic knee problem but has featured consistently for his club side this season.

A lack of height remains a problem in the Japanese rearguard, with Nakazawa standing tallest at 6ft 1in. Although his positional awareness is impressive, he will need to have his wits about him if he is to help repel Brazil, Australia and Croatia in Group F.

Like most Japanese players, Nakazawa has an unusual nickname. 'Bomberhead' may suggest he poses some sort of security threat but instead it is apparently a reference to a previous haircut involving plentiful dreadlocks.
